RELATIONSHIPS KEEP THE DIRT MOVING

Digging dirt for over 118 years has taught Enebak Construction (ECC) a thing or two. Across its four generations as a family-owned business, they have consistently called upon these lessons, even amid technological advancements and operational shifts. Perhaps the most grounding lesson of all continues to be this: relationships are what keep the dirt moving.

It is no coincidence that ECC’s primary source of work is with repeat clients, some of whom they have been working with for 40-plus years. It is the result of their devotion to building strong, trustworthy relationships with clients, a principle that remains at the heart of each project executed. It's simple, really—prioritize people, and the rest will fall into place.

ECC does not just apply this value to their direct clients, but to the many other contacts they encounter across the various stages of each project. For over 50 years, they have maintained mutually beneficial relationships with industry professionals including engineers, testing companies, subcontractors, banks, and equipment providers—allowing them to maximize value for their clients and each other.

Perhaps most importantly, ECC fosters strong, meaningful relationships within its own employees and other TRADITION entities, prioritizing its team’s happiness and connectedness every step of the way.

This is why ECC is still digging dirt more than 100 years later. Strong relationships build trust, and trust builds confidence. Confidence that allows them to always perform with their clients’, trade partners’, and employees’ best interest in mind. That’s what keeps the dirt moving.

AN ICE-BREAKING TRIBUTE TO MILITARY, FAMILY, AND SPORTS

In November, TRADITION and United Heroes League (UHL) celebrated a very special Veterans Day, when they cut the ribbon on the brand new SCHEELS® Rink at the Tradition Veterans Complex in Hastings, MN. The new venue gets to the heart of UHL’s mission, summed up by president and founder Shane Hudella in three simple words: “military, family, and sports.” Veterans, families, supporters, and community members gathered to witness the grand opening, along with Zach Parise and Devan Dubnyk, former Minnesota Wild players who signed autographs for enthusiastic fans. The NHL-size rink is designated as a space for military kids and Veterans to play, unwind, connect, and excel at the sport of hockey.

Hudella referred to the exciting day as “one step in a bigger plan,” as UHL continues building the nation’s first sports complex for military kids and Veterans. TRADITION is proud to work alongside the UHL team as they continue changing the lives of military members and families across the country.

UNITED HEROES LEAGUE: HELPING MILITARY KIDS UNLEASH THEIR INNER HERO

In many ways, sports can reflect the game of life. While scoring goals, beating records, and achieving new milestones is thrilling, it is the relationships built and the lessons learned through each game that truly matter.

Yet for some children, participating in a sport they love isn’t so simple. Especially military kids, who often face greater obstacles to achieving their sports dreams.

“Sports challenge you and build character for everything else you do in life.”
- HOWIE LONG Former NFL defensive end

UNITED HEROES LEAGUE STRIVES TO ELIMINATE THESE OBSTACLES.

Founded by military Veteran Shane Hudella, the Minnesota-based nonprofit works to ensure that children of military families are afforded every opportunity to actively participate in sports. With the aid of generous volunteers, donations, and fundraisers, United Heroes League (UHL) has been able to provide military kids and their families with over $25 million worth of free coaching, sports equipment, game tickets, and cash grants. With this aid, thousands of kids across the U.S. and Canada have been empowered to chase their athletic dreams, whether it be soccer, tennis, hockey, or anything in between—UHL provides support across 14 different sporting pursuits!

SPIRIT OF BRANDTJEN FARM

Spirit of Brandtjen Farm in Lakeville is truly a cornerstone of TRADITION. Under land acquisition and development from 2005-2023, the massive project was nearly 20 years in the making. The 540-acre neighborhood features 1,000 single family homes, 369 apartment rentals, miles of walking trails, two community centers with pools, an elementary school, and convenient grocery and retail options. What residents refer to as “The Barn'' is a hallmark of the community, a common gathering space located inside of a historic dairy barn that has been restored to reflect the neighborhood's quality craftsmanship.

THE HARVEST OF CHASKA

The Harvest of Chaska is an amenity-rich community in Chaska that offers the perfect balance of peaceful country life and convenient city perks. Residential development for the neighborhood began in 2013 and final lots were completed in 2023. The Harvest boasts approximately 345 total acres and 506 single family units, set against the gorgeous backdrop of rolling green hills, wooded ravines, and river valley views. Pedestrian-friendly streets wind through the neighborhood, and community gathering spaces including playgrounds, parks, and walking paths make for a friendly, tight-knit atmosphere.

BECAUSE THEY SERVED US FIRST

PROVIDING SUPPORT TO VETERANS ACROSS THE COMMUNITY AS THEY FIND NEW PURPOSE AFTER MILITARY SERVICE

In 2009, a fated encounter brought two families with generous hearts together. Tom and Jessi McKenna met Scott and Deb Marrier while picking up quilts from a small church in Wisconsin. The two couples quickly connected on their mutual desire to serve homeless Veterans. In one small moment, the seeds were planted for a much larger impact than the two families could have realized. Every Third Saturday (ETS) was born.

With the help of the Hands Foundation and the Marrier family, Tom and Jessi co-founded ETS, with a core mission focused on fostering hope and supporting post-traumatic growth. From their permanent building in Minneapolis, ETS provides a resource center and community hub for Veterans and their families, where they can connect, obtain support, and find new purpose after military service.

The resources offered at ETS are designed to promote that sense of community, which allows ETS to meet each Veteran where they are and assess needs on an individual basis. ETS supplies clothing and hygiene items, provides a monthly meal, grants access to its fitness center, offers an empowerment course called Warrior's Return, employs Veterans through an internship, and connects Veterans to other services as needed.

36 |
spring 2024 COMMUNITY SPOTLIGHT

In 2023, ETS helped over 60 Veterans with emergency assistance, responded to 270 Veterans who reached out for support via the ETS Pop Smoke Resource, celebrated 43 Veterans who graduated Warrior's Return, and saw the ETS Supply Store utilized over 2,200 times by Veterans and their families. But the most impactful changes are those that cannot be measured or seen. These are changes that result when Veterans and their families are embraced by a loving, supportive community and are empowered to rediscover their purpose.

HENDRICKSON FOUNDATION’S 7TH ANNUAL NATIONAL HOCKEY FESTIVAL

In June 2023, the Hendrickson Foundation put on its 7th Annual National Hockey Festival at the NSC Super Rink in Blaine, MN. As a yearly sponsor of the event, TRADITION was proud to witness this year’s astounding success. The four-day event drew 1,300 hockey players from across the country to compete in a celebratory tournament composed of multiple programs of play, including Warrior, Sled, Special, Blind, and Deaf/Hard of Hearing. Across the 80 teams that participated, 29 states were represented, from Alaska all the way to Florida. Players vied to take home the coveted championship belt, which is awarded to the winning team in each division. But even those who fell short of the prize still went home victorious, with new friends and memories to last a lifetime.

A giant reception followed the tournament, in which players were able to meet, connect, and celebrate their achievements together. Among its festivities was a festival plunge, live music, food, drinks, and more. For that joyful weekend, the festival provided a space where players didn't have to think or talk about any challenges they may face, but instead play a sport they love, surrounded by a community that uplifts them. Safe to say, the Hendrickson Foundation’s motto rang true— “Hockey Changes Lives®.”

HOCKEY IS FOR EVERYONE

The Hendrickson Foundation aims to break barriers and promote inclusion in the sport of hockey, so that everyone can experience its gratifying, life-changing effects. The nonprofit proudly supports seven different programs for play, each targeted at eliminating barriers to play presented by different physical or cognitive challenges. These programs have grown to include over 40 diversified teams with over 850 athletes.

The MN Wild Blind Hockey - for those with vision impairment.

The MN Wild Special Program - for individuals with developmental disabilities.

The MN Wild Deaf/Hard of Hearing Program was recently launched and is the first of its kind in the country.

Rochester Mustangs Sled Hockey - for people with disabilities.

The MN Wild Sled Hockey - for those with physical disabilities.

The MN Wild Warriors Program - for U.S. Military Veterans with disabilities.

Hope Hurricanes Sled Hockey - a FargoMoorhead-based program for sled hockey.

WHAT IS TITLE INSURANCE?

Title insurance is all about reducing the financial risk involved in property transactions. Few may be aware just how high this risk is—according to industry statistics, one in four residential real estate transactions have some sort of defect. Title insurance protects buyers against any losses that may result from these defects, acting as an advocate throughout the oftentimes intimidating closing process.

RAISING A GLASS TO TRADITION

The latest batch of Tradition Whiskey carries history on its label—literally. Across each bottle is a 1946 photo of Bob Enebak, the second-generation operator of Enebak Construction and father of TRADITION founder Tip Enebak. The treasured photo is a call back to what this unique whiskey is all about: preserving tradition.

The new batch of Tradition Whiskey is a straight rye whiskey, aged for five years before bottling. On the nose, drinkers will pick up subtle hints of toasted black peppercorn, orange peels, and caramel corn. The palate will then reveal warm cinnamon, vanilla, allspice, and honey.

Tradition Whiskey was a collaboration from members of the TRADITION team to create a unique and exclusive gift for employees and business connections.

CARTER’S SAZERAC

• 2 oz. Tradition Straight Rye Whiskey

• ¼ oz. turbinado simple syrup

• ¼ oz. absinthe

• 3 dashes peychaud's bitters

Combine Tradition Straight Rye Whiskey, turbinado simple syrup, absinthe, and peychaud’s bitters. Stir over ice for 20 seconds and strain into a chilled rocks glass. Serve neat and garnish with a lemon twist.
